Why Is the YDS Still One of Turkey’s Toughest Language Exams?
The Foreign Language Exam (YDS) remains a critical threshold for anyone pursuing an academic career in Turkey or needing a foreign language certificate for public institutions. The exam puts candidates through a rigorous filter across four core areas: vocabulary knowledge, grammar, reading comprehension, and translation. The vast majority of the questions can’t be answered with superficial English knowledge alone; they require linguistic analysis, contextual reading, and academic discourse comprehension skills.
Hundreds of thousands of candidates take the YDS across Turkey every year. Yet the proportion of those scoring above 80 remains quite low. Scoring above 90 truly demands a genuinely specialized preparation process. At this point, the traditional approach of simply solving question banks falls short on its own; candidates need a personalized learning model that identifies their strengths and weaknesses.

The Five Core Pillars of a 90+ Score Strategy
1. Systematically Expanding Your Academic Vocabulary
The core difficulty of YDS questions lies in their focus on understanding academic and technical texts. That’s why it’s essential to internalize word groups that frequently appear in academic discourse, not everyday conversational English. 2. Learning Grammar Structures in Context
YDS grammar questions can be answered not through rote memorization, but through analyzing function within sentences. Advanced grammar topics such as participial phrases, inversion structures, and the use of the subjunctive mood need to be learned not just as rules, but through examples embedded in text. 3. Simultaneously Increasing Reading Comprehension Speed and Depth
Time management in the YDS is a critical variable that many candidates overlook. The texts are long and dense, and the questions are designed in a way that misleads those who read superficially. 4. Developing Logic for Translation and Sentence Completion Questions
These question types are among the areas where most candidates lose the most points on the YDS. Translation questions require both grammatical accuracy and fidelity of meaning at the same time. In sentence completion, contextual coherence and discourse logic are decisive. Common Traits of Candidates Who Score 90+ on the YDS
When examining high-scoring candidates, certain common traits stand out. Consistency comes first. Rather than studying intensively for 10 hours a week, doing focused practice regularly for 1-1.5 hours every day produces far more effective results. The second trait is recording mistakes. Successful candidates don’t just mark the questions they got wrong—they also note why they got them wrong.
The third common trait is regular exposure to different text types. The YDS measures not just grammar, but comprehension and interpretation skills. The e-YDS Difference: The Key to Success in the Online Exam
The e-YDS shares the same content as the traditional YDS, but the exam takes place on a screen. This difference is a factor that shouldn’t be overlooked in terms of candidate psychology.
